Understanding Fertility Scans Fertility scans are diagnostic procedures that utilize ultrasound technology to visualize the reproductive organs. They provide insight into various factors affecting fertility, including ovarian reserve, uterine health, and the presence of conditions like polycystic ovary syndrome (PCOS) or endometriosis. By assessing these elements, fertility scans play an integral role in formulating personalized fertility plans. The Science Behind Fertility Scans Fertility scans primarily include transvaginal and abdominal ultrasounds. Transvaginal ultrasounds involve the insertion of a transducer into the vagina, providing high-resolution images of the ovaries, uterus, and surrounding structures. This method is particularly valuable in evaluating follicle development during ovulation. Abdominal ultrasounds, while less commonly used for fertility assessments, can also offer valuable insights, especially when examining the uterus and its shape. Both techniques are non-invasive, quick, and generally free of the side effects associated with more invasive diagnostic procedures. The Benefits of Fertility Scans One of the most significant advantages of fertility scans is their ability to identify and quantify ovarian reserves. This is particularly important for women considering delayed parenthood, as the number and quality of eggs decrease with age. Understanding ovarian reserve can guide women in making informed choices regarding family planning. Fertility scans also play a pivotal role in diagnosing conditions that affect fertility. For instance, the presence of uterine fibroids or abnormalities can be detected early, allowing for timely interventions that could enhance the chances of conception. Individualized Treatment Plans Following the results of a fertility scan, doctors can develop tailored treatment plans. Depending on the findings, lifestyle changes, medical interventions, or assisted reproductive technologies like in vitro fertilization (IVF) may be recommended. In cases where fertility scans reveal issues, such as blocked fallopian tubes or hormonal imbalances, physicians can recommend specific treatments to address these problems. This personalized approach not only increases the likelihood of conception but also reduces the emotional and financial strain of prolonged infertility treatments. This education can foster a sense of agency and lessen feelings of helplessness. Challenges and Limitations Despite their myriad benefits, fertility scans are not without limitations. They provide a snapshot of reproductive health but do not always account for the complex interplay of genetic, environmental, and emotional factors affecting fertility. Additionally, the availability of fertility scans can vary widely by region and healthcare system, with underserved populations facing barriers to access. Moreover, the psychological impact of receiving potentially negative news from a fertility scan can be profound. Patients may experience a range of emotions, from fear and worry to despair. Therefore, it’s essential for healthcare providers to offer comprehensive counseling and support alongside medical interventions. Fertility scans are diagnostic tests that utilize ultrasound technology to assess reproductive organs and identify any potential issues that may affect an individual’s ability to conceive. Depending on the specific concerns, these scans can be performed on the uterus, ovaries, and other related structures. Types of Fertility Scans There are primarily two types of fertility scans that are common in reproductive medicine: Transvaginal Ultrasound: This is the most common type of fertility scan, utilizing a small probe inserted into the vagina to get a close-up view of the ovaries, uterus, and fallopian tubes. It is particularly useful for monitoring ovarian follicles (the sacs that contain eggs) and assessing uterine health. Hysterosalpingography (HSG): This is a specialized X-ray procedure that involves injecting a contrast dye into the uterine cavity through the cervix. It helps to visualize the shape of the uterus and check if the fallopian tubes are open—an essential factor for fertility. Why Are Fertility Scans Important? Fertility scans play a crucial role in diagnosing issues related to reproduction. The following points illustrate their importance: Identifying Ovulatory Disorders: Scans can help determine if ovulation is occurring regularly by monitoring follicle growth and estrogen levels. Detecting Structural Abnormalities: They can identify conditions such as uterine fibroids, polyp formations, and any anatomical issues in the reproductive tract that could impede conception. Evaluating Endometriosis: Transvaginal ultrasound can help identify endometriosis, a condition that may cause pain and affect fertility. Guiding Treatment Plans: Results from fertility scans enable healthcare providers to tailor treatment options effectively, whether that be medication, lifestyle changes, or assisted reproductive technologies like IVF. What to Expect During a Fertility Scan The idea of undergoing a fertility scan can be intimidating for many, but understanding the process can help alleviate some anxieties. Here’s what you can generally expect: Preparation Before your appointment, your healthcare provider may give specific instructions, such as timing the scan with your menstrual cycle (typically performed in the follicular phase). Drink water beforehand for abdominal scans as it can enhance visibility; however, you should check with your doctor about fasting or other preparations. The Procedure During a transvaginal ultrasound, you will lie on an examination table, and a healthcare professional will gently insert a probe into your vagina. This probe emits sound waves that create images of your reproductive organs on a monitor. The procedure usually lasts about 15 to 30 minutes. The HSG involves a similar setup but uses a speculum to visualize the cervix. A dye will be injected to check for blockages or abnormalities. You may experience mild discomfort, but the procedure is generally quick. After the Scan After the scan, there may be a few recommendations depending on the results. If no immediate concerns are identified, your healthcare provider will discuss the next steps based on the scan’s findings. In cases where abnormalities are detected, further investigations or referrals to specialists may be required. Common Concerns and Misconceptions Many individuals have questions or concerns about fertility scans. Here are some common misconceptions clarified: Fertility Scans Are Painful: While some patients may experience slight discomfort, most report it to be a non-painful experience. Only Women Need Fertility Scans: Fertility issues can affect both partners, and assessments may also include male fertility evaluations. Fertility Scans Are Only for Infertility Cases: They can also be beneficial for pre-conception assessments for couples who want to plan their families.
